"American Idol" champion Taylor Hicks has signed a contract with 19 Recordings Limited and Arista Records, according to a published report. Simon Fuller, the creator of the British import, owns 19 Recordings Limited, Billboard.com reported on Wednesday.The singer - who polled 36.4 million votes in last week's final - is now on the same label, Arista, as 2005 finalist Carrie Underwood.
Hicks, 29, said: "I want to get a quick turnaround on my album. Get it on the shelves within the next five or six months, by the end of the year, something like that."
A two track CD featuring his show stopping finale, 'Do I Make You Proud', and a cover of the Doobie Brothers classic, 'Takin' It to the Streets' was 5th on Billboard's charts today and has already become Amazon.com's fifth-biggest music seller - two weeks before its official release on June 13.
